Force Select

Stop Discuz! X2.5 from disabling selection of text

このスクリプトの質問や評価の投稿はこちら通報はこちらへお寄せください
// ==UserScript==
// @name         Force Select
// @version      1.0
// @description  Stop Discuz! X2.5 from disabling selection of text
// @author       Penn
// @match        *://pieayu.com/*
// @grant        none
// @namespace https://greasyfork.org/users/228651
// ==/UserScript==

(function() {
    'use strict';

    let style = document.createElement('style');
    style.innerHTML = 'html{ user-select: text !important; }';

    document.body.appendChild(style);

    // Create the script to remove the nodrag from chrome
    var script = document.createElement('script');
    script.type='text/javascript';
    script.innerHTML = "document.body.onmouseup = function() { return true }; document.body.onselect = function() { return true }; document.body.onselectstart = function() { return true }; document.body.onmousedown = function() { return true };";
    var body = document.getElementsByTagName('body')[0];
    body.appendChild(script);

})();